If you keep repeating yourself on YouTube, you already have a product
If you have explained the same problem in three different YouTube videos, that is not a content problem. That is a packaging signal. Most people keep recording the answer again and again because they think more views will fix it. Usually the smarter move is to turn that repeated answer into something small people can buy. Here is the simple version: 1. Find the question you keep answering. 2. Turn your best answer into a checklist, template, or short guide. 3. Mention that product every time that question shows up in your videos. Now YouTube is not just teaching. It is pointing people to a clear next step. You do not need a huge course. You need one useful thing that solves one annoying problem fast. That is how a channel starts acting like a business instead of a hobby. The best YouTube video for sales is not always the one with the most views
A lot of creators think the winning YouTube video is the one that goes widest. That is true if your only plan is ad money. It is usually false if you want a digital product to sell. The better question is this: Which video pulls the right person into the right problem? A 2,000 view video can beat a 20,000 view video if the smaller one brings people who are ready for a solution. Here is what I would watch instead: 1. Which video brings the most specific comments? 2. Which video makes people ask how to do the next step? 3. Which video attracts the same kind of problem over and over? 4. Which problem could you solve with one simple paid tool? That is the video I would build the product around. A lot of people are chasing bigger traffic when they should be chasing cleaner intent. Big reach feels good. Clear demand pays better. YouTube gets easier when the product comes first
A lot of creators are trying to make YouTube pay them before they have built anything to sell. That is why the math feels slow. If every video ends with more content, more content, and more content, the viewer gets entertained but your business stays weak. The better move is simpler: 1. Pick one problem you can solve clearly. 2. Turn that solution into a small digital product. 3. Make YouTube videos that bring the right people to that product. Now the channel has a job. You are not hoping views somehow become money. You are using views to bring the right person into the right solution. Most people have this backward. They build the audience first and leave the offer for later. That usually means more work, more waiting, and less money. Build the small product first. Then let YouTube do what it does best.
